Have to disagree with this. I often set up cameras in areas to take inventories where I know i will ONLY get nighttime photos. Scouting then tells me where to hunt for him. If you are consistently running cameras in an area where you are getting daytime photos you are going to educate that buck because you are in his core area - that is where you need to hunt and kill him - not take his photo - IMO

Well I can understand your viewpoint, however, nite time photos and their times provides you with much needed intell, such as travel direction, times, bachelor groups he traveling with, temperature, location, and dates. You can generate plenty of information. If your getting random day time photos and a overwhelming nitetime photos your in the game...dont underestimate his ability to stay close and undetected. Believe me a mature buck holds the playing cards...but it's up to you to dissect his bedding and security sanctuary he feels safe in.
